DHCP Relay Option 60 Settings
This window is used to configure option 60 relay rules on the Switch. Different strings can be specified for the same
relay server, and the same string can be specified with multiple relay servers. The system will relay the packet to all
the matching servers.
To view this window, click Configuration > DHCP Relay > DHCP Relay Option 60 Settings as shown below:
The following parameters may be configured.

Description
Enter the specified string, up to a maximum of 255 alphanumeric characters.
Enter the relay server IP address.
Use the drop down menu to select either Exact Match or Partial Match.
Exact Match – The option 60 string in the packet must fully match the specified string.
Partial Match – The option 60 string in the packet only needs to partially match the specified
string.
